Default Setting up Twin 40 Webers on My Pinto 2L

Ok guys thinking caps on. What do i need to get this on my Escort.

Now i know i need a manifold (anyone got one to sell?) but how much hosing do you think? what about the throttle etc etc?

Ok you have said manifold - check
Throttle linkage - I use a std 2ltr one with a bracket welded onto the rocker cover
vacuum setup - depending on cam can be a bit of an issue (lack of vaccum)- some tap points to all 4 cylinders...
Battery location - can get very tight depending on size of battery _ relocate to boot?
Fuel pump - a standard pump might keep up????? most run electric

thats just of the top of my head
